Spicy Crock Pot Chicken

What began as an experiment in slow cooking chicken has turned into a very flavorful dish. Instead of slow cooking in chicken stock or beer (which is great, too!), we tried a mixture of jalapeno pickling juice and apple juice with loads of spicy seasonings. We loved the result.

Ingredients

  • 1 whole chicken, rinsed and patted dry
  • 1 cup apple cider
  • ½ jar pickled jalapeno peppers, juices included
  • 3 heaping tablespoons Italian seasoning
  • 2 tablespoons chili powder
  • 2 tablespoons dried parsley flakes
  • 1 tablespoon minced garlic

Cooking Directions

  • Drop all ingredients into the slow cooker and stir it up around the chicken. If you’d like, you can season the chicken inside and out with your seasonings, but it really isn’t necessary with this dish. Just drop it all in.
  • Slow cook at medium level about 3 hours. You can leave it in longer for more tenderness, but you might need to reduce the heat levels.
  • Carve your chicken and serve!

NOTE: You can pour some of the juices over your carved chicken to make it that much juicier, or whisk it with a bit of cornstarch and milk mixture to form a gravy.
